Crash at 28th milestone
A rider was killed during this morning's (Mon) Supersport Race 1.
Newcomer Adam Lyon, from Helensburgh in Scotland, crashed at Casey's, just after the 28th milestone on the third lap of the race.
The 26-year-old had qualified in 24th place for today’s race with a fastest lap of 122.261mph, which he improved to 122.636mph on the opening lap of today’s race.
During Friday's practice session he had lapped at 123.44 mph.
Race organiser ACU Events Ltd has passed on its deepest sympathies to Adam's family and friends.
